The root causes of overheating in mining machines are as varied as the cryptocurrencies they support. Overclocked processors, inadequate cooling systems, or even environmental factors like Australia’s sweltering summer heat can push these beasts to their limits. Diving deeper, the anatomy of a mining rig reveals why overheating is such a persistent foe. A typical setup includes powerful GPUs or ASICs dedicated to hashing algorithms, coupled with cooling solutions that must withstand continuous operation. For BTC enthusiasts, ASIC miners like the Antminer series are staples, but without proper ventilation in a mining farm, they can overheat faster than a viral tweet.
